NFL Free Agency Frenzy: Key Moves and Surprises

Welcome to the thrilling world of NFL free agency, where the landscape of the league can shift dramatically in just a few days. The legal negotiation window has opened, and the action is already heating up. Players are set to officially sign with new teams after 4 p.m. ET on Wednesday, marking the start of the new league year. Let’s dive into the whirlwind of trades, signings, and rumors that have already made headlines.

One of the most talked-about moves is Joey Bosa joining the Buffalo Bills on a one-year deal. This addition is sure to bolster the Bills’ defense, and fans are eager to see how Bosa will fit into the team’s strategy. With his impressive track record, Bosa is expected to make a significant impact on the field.

But Bosa’s move is just the tip of the iceberg. In recent days, we’ve seen a flurry of trades that have reshaped team rosters. Wide receiver DK Metcalf has been traded to the Pittsburgh Steelers, while quarterback Geno Smith is now with the Las Vegas Raiders. Meanwhile, offensive tackle Laremy Tunsil has found a new home with the Washington Commanders.

In a surprising turn of events, Sam Darnold has secured a $100 million contract, taking over Smith’s spot in Seattle. The New York Jets have signed Justin Fields, and Daniel Jones is now with the Indianapolis Colts. These quarterback moves are sure to have a ripple effect across the league as teams adjust their strategies.

Several players have opted to stay with their current teams, re-signing to continue their careers where they have already made a mark. Edge rusher Khalil Mack, offensive tackle Ronnie Stanley, and receiver Chris Godwin have all decided to remain with their respective teams, providing stability and continuity.

Other notable moves include Davante Adams joining the Los Angeles Rams, cornerback D.J. Reed heading to the Detroit Lions, and edge rusher Josh Sweat signing with the Arizona Cardinals. Defensive tackle Milton Williams will be strengthening the New England Patriots’ defense, adding depth to their lineup.
